Principal Software Engineer (ai / Agentic Developer Productivity)

Microsoft Microsoft · Big Tech · Redmond, WA +1 · Software Engineering

Principal Software Engineer to build and scale the agentic AI platform for developer productivity at Microsoft, focusing on orchestration of AI models and agentic workflows for internal developers.

What you'd actually do

  1. Own and deliver complete features across the development lifecycle, including design, architecture, implementation, testability, debugging, shipping, and servicing.
  2. Use AI in your daily coding and advocate to the team and customers an evolving state-of-the-art of how best to do this.
  3. Demonstrate resiliency to experiment and try multiple AI approaches that may not work — because no one has tried them before.
  4. Provide mentorship and coaching to engineers in, and beyond, your team.
  5. Write and review clean, well-thought-out code with an emphasis on quality, performance, simplicity, durability, scalability, and maintainability.

Skills

Required

  • Bachelor's Degree in Computer Science or related technical field AND 6+ years technical engineering experience with coding in languages including, but not limited to, C, C++, C#, Java, JavaScript, or Python OR equivalent experience.

Nice to have

  • Prior experience building with Agent SDKs, large language models (LLMs), prompt engineering, or AI orchestration frameworks (e.g., LangChain, Semantic Kernel, AutoGen, LlamaIndex, or similar).
  • Familiarity with agentic AI development patterns — multi-step reasoning, tool/function calling, retrieval-augmented generation (RAG), and human-in-the-loop workflows.
  • Proven experience as a Software Engineer delivering large-scale, production-quality systems.
  • Solid software engineering fundamentals: system design, algorithms, testing, debugging, and code review.
  • Demonstrated ability to lead technical direction and mentor peers in a collaborative team environment.
  • Comfort working in ambiguous, fast-moving problem spaces where best practices are still being established.
  • Hands-on experience with AI-powered developer tooling and coding assistants, such as: GitHub Copilot and Copilot Workspace, Claude Code, OpenAI Codex / ChatGPT, Cursor.
  • Prior experience using agentic plugins, agents, skills, hooks, etc.
  • Experience dogfooding, evaluating, and forming opinions on emerging AI developer tools, and translating those insights into team-wide best practices.
  • Background in developer tooling, build systems, CI/CD pipelines, or engineering systems at scale.
